titleOfInvention 18-methyl-19-nor-20-keto-pregnanes and process for their manufacture
abstract 1512258 18 - Methyl - 19 - nor - 20 - ketopregnanes SCHERING AG 4 Aug 1975 [5 Aug 1974] 32477/75 Heading C2U Novel steroids of the formula (wherein R 1 and R 2 together are oxo, or one of them is H and the other OH, R 3 is oxo or H 2 and 5-H is α or #) are prepared by treating steroids of the formula which contain an optional #<SP>4</SP>-double bond, with an alkali or alkaline earth metal in liquid ammonia and, if desired, re-oxidizing any keto group that is reduced by the treatment, or by hydrogenating steroids of the formula which contain a #<SP>4</SP>- and/or a #<SP>16</SP>-double bond, and, if desired, selectively reducing a resulting 3-ketone to a 3-ol. In one example a resulting 3#-ol is converted to 3α-formyloxy-18-methyl- 19 - nor - 5α - pregnan - 20 - one and this is then hydrolysed to the corresponding 3α-ol. 17# - Acetoxy - 18 - methyl - 19 - nor - 5#,17α- pregnane - 3,20 - dione and the corresponding 5α - compound are prepared from 17α - ethynyl - 17# - acetoxy - 18 - methyl - #<SP>4</SP>- estren - 3 - one by converting this to 17#- acetoxy - 18 - methyl - 19 - nor - 17α - #<SP>4</SP> - pregnen - 3,20 - dione and catalytically hydrogenating this. 18 - Methyl - 19 - nor - #<SP>4'16</SP>- pregnadiene - 3,20 - dione is prepared from 17- ethynyl - 18 - methyl - #<SP>4'16</SP> - cotradien - 3 - one. The novel steroids have a central-depressive anaesthetic-narcotic action and anticonvulsive activity, and they may be made up into pharmaceutical compositions with suitable carriers.
